引言
多边形不规则框架在建筑设计、工业设计、游戏开发等领域有着广泛的应用。掌握多边形不规则框架的绘制技巧,对于设计师和开发者来说至关重要。本文将详细介绍多边形不规则框架的绘制方法,从入门到精通,帮助您轻松掌握这一技能。
第一章:入门基础
1.1 多边形不规则框架的定义
多边形不规则框架是指由多个不规则多边形组成的框架结构。这些多边形可以是三角形、四边形、五边形等,它们通过公共边相连,形成一个封闭的框架。
1.2 绘制工具的选择
绘制多边形不规则框架,您可以选择以下工具:
- 手绘:使用铅笔、尺子、圆规等传统工具进行绘制。
- 计算机绘图软件:如AutoCAD、SketchUp、3ds Max等。
- 图形设计软件:如Adobe Illustrator、CorelDRAW等。
1.3 绘制步骤
- 确定多边形数量和形状:根据设计需求,确定多边形的数量和形状。
- 绘制基本多边形:使用选择的工具,绘制基本的多边形。
- 连接多边形:将相邻的多边形通过公共边连接起来。
- 调整和完善:检查框架的连接是否牢固,对不合理的部分进行调整。
第二章:进阶技巧
2.1 空间布局优化
在绘制多边形不规则框架时,需要注意空间布局的优化,以下是一些优化技巧:
- 对称性:尽量使框架具有对称性,提高美观度。
- 平衡性:确保框架的重量分布均匀,避免倾斜。
- 层次感:通过大小、颜色等手段,增强框架的层次感。
2.2 细节处理
在绘制过程中,细节处理是关键。以下是一些细节处理技巧:
- 线条粗细:根据框架的尺寸和设计风格,选择合适的线条粗细。
- 填充颜色:合理选择填充颜色,使框架更具视觉冲击力。
- 阴影效果:为框架添加阴影效果,增强立体感。
第三章:实战案例
3.1 案例一:建筑设计
以下是一个建筑设计的案例,展示如何使用AutoCAD绘制多边形不规则框架。
# AutoCAD代码示例
import cadquery as cq
# 创建一个多边形不规则框架
frame = cq.Workplane("XY").rect(100, 50).move(0, 0).extrude(20)
# 创建一个三角形,并连接到框架上
triangle = cq.Workplane("XY").triangle(50, 50).move(100, 0).extrude(20)
frame = frame + triangle
# 保存框架
frame.export('frame.stl')
3.2 案例二:游戏开发
以下是一个游戏开发中的案例,展示如何使用Unity绘制多边形不规则框架。
// Unity代码示例
using UnityEngine;
public class PolygonFrame : MonoBehaviour
{
public GameObject trianglePrefab;
public GameObject framePrefab;
void Start()
{
// 创建框架
GameObject frame = Instantiate(framePrefab, Vector3.zero, Quaternion.identity);
// 创建三角形并连接到框架
GameObject triangle = Instantiate(trianglePrefab, new Vector3(100, 0, 0), Quaternion.identity);
frame.transform.Find("Triangle").transform.position = triangle.transform.position;
}
}
第四章:总结
通过本文的介绍,相信您已经对多边形不规则框架的绘制技巧有了全面的了解。从入门到精通,只需掌握基础、进阶技巧,并多加练习,您一定能轻松掌握这一技能。希望本文对您有所帮助!
